The engine is a 3.5HP one about 25 years old. It runs reasonably well until
you increase the revs and then the flywheel key (the square bit that turns
the engine for starting - I don't know what else to call it) seems to engage
and drives the starting coil, which makes a terrible screeching sound and
threatens to wreck the mechanism, we have to shut it down at this point.
Anyone got any ideas what the problem might be?

sounds like a broken spring in the recoil mechanism allowing it to engage 
when the revs rise, but i may be wrong, if i am someone will jump all over 
me  and put us both right  :)
